Naxalite attack brings Asia's largest bauxite mine to a halt

An eight-hour gun-battle between security forces and Naxalites at the Panchapatmali bauxite mines of the National Aluminium Company Ltd in Koraput district of Orissa ended early morning today, leaving 10 jawans of the Central Industrial Security Force (CISF) and four Naxalites dead. Orissa puts a rider for mine licence to Nalco

The Orissa government has remaining licence to the National Aluminium Company (Nalco). The state government said the company can be given a prospective licence on the Potangi bauxite mines only if it agrees to give the Sashubahumali Pasangamali reserve to the Orissa Mining Corporation (OMC).
